IEC 63399:2024
Household and similar electrical rice cookers - Methods for measuring the performance

About This Item
IEC 63399:2024 provides a technical reference for evaluating the performance of household and similar electrical rice cookers. Purpose of IEC 63399:2024
The purpose of IEC 63399:2024 is to establish methods for measuring the performance of household and similar electrical rice cookers in a repeatable and technically defensible way.
